Dill scores four for Bermuda in coach Robinson’s last game
Bermuda 5 Grenada 3
Bermuda came from behind in an eight-goal thriller to give outgoing head coach Naquita Robinson the perfect send off after she announced her retirement shortly before kick-off at Flora Duffy Stadium on Saturday night.
The Lady Gombey Warriors got off to a dreadful start in their final Concacaf Women’s Qualifier as the Grenadians jumped out to a 3-0 lead with Robinson watching from the stands after she was sent from the bench by Mexican referee Priscila Perez.
However, Bermuda rallied to score five unanswered goals with FC United of Manchester forward Keunna Dill leading the charge with four and Bournemouth midfielder Kenni Thompson grabbing the other to complete a remarkable comeback in front of 715 home fans that were kept on the edge of their seats by the high-scoring, entertaining contest.
Melania Fullerton, Sheranda Charles and captain Nia Fleming-Thompson were on target for Grenada.
